About your trip

Sweeter by Nature is an inspiring collaboration between Surf & Ko and the NGO Osa Ecology. It creates a retreat that celebrates movement on water and land while dedicated to supporting local marine and cultural conservation initiatives.

About your organizer

Surf & Ko is a Costa Rican social enterprise that promotes biocultural tourism. We offer community and ecological experiences for those who want to escape mass tourism and discover the Costa Rica that local communities build. By traveling with us, you will enjoy the impressive landscapes and biodiversity of this side of the world and financially support local communities, their tourism services, and socio-environmental projects.
